Reliability
Broker | Plus500 | XM |
---|---|---|
Reliability | 5/5 | 5/5 |
Foundation Year | 2007 | 2009 |
Regulated in Countries | Cyprus, United Kingdom, Australia, Seychelles, Estonia, Singapore, United States | Belize, Cyprus, Australia, United Arab Emirates |
Regulators | CySEC CySEC FCA FCA ASIC ASIC NZ FMA NZ FMA FSCA FSCA SFSA SFSA EFSA EFSA MAS MAS CFTC CFTC NFA NFA | BFSC BFSC CySEC CySEC ASIC ASIC DFSA DFSA |
Plus500
Plus500 is registered and regulated in several jurisdictions by authoritative bodies. This means that the broker is required to adhere to strict financial standards and provide regular reports on its activities to regulators.
XM
XM Group is highly regarded for its reliability, holding ASIC, CySEC, FSC, and DFSA licenses.

Markets and Products
Broker | Plus500 | XM |
---|---|---|
Markets and Products | 5/5 | 5/5 |
Forex | 65 | 55 |
Precious Metals | 5 | 3 |
Energy Carriers | 7 | 3 |
Soft Commodities | 10 | 8 |
Indices | 36 | 50 |
Stocks | 1550 | 1307 |
ETF | 96 | - |
Cryptocurrency | - | 58 |
Plus500
Plus500 offers a deep diversity of products and markets, including CFDs on currencies, indices, commodities, stocks, and ETFs from various countries worldwide.
XM
The broker offers a wide range of markets and products, including over 1500 items.
Pros
- A large selection of currency pairs.
- Access to CFDs on various assets.
- The ability to trade cryptocurrencies.
